Garmin Instinct rugged smartwatch goes official
Garmin has just announced the immediate availability of yet another smartwatch aimed at adventurers – Instinct. Garmin Instinct is a rugged smartwatch built for outdoor activities, which doesn't come cheap at all.

The smartwatch is now available for purchase in three colors – Graphite, Flame Red, and Tundra, for $300. Garmin Instinct promises 14 days of battery life in smartwatch mode, 16 hours in GPS mode, or up to 40 hours in UltraTrac battery save mode.

According to Garmin, the Instinct features military-grade 810G standard for thermal, shock and water resistance (up to 100m). It's packed in fiber reinforced polymer case and boasts a “chemically strengthened and scratch-resistant display.” This is a monochrome display that's perfectly visible in the sunlight and features 128 x 128 pixels resolution.

It's got all sorts of tracking capabilities and sensors, including GPS, GLONASS, and Galileo, as well as 3-axis compass, barometric altimeter, accelerometer, thermometer, and heart rate monitor. It lacks NFC (Near Field Communication) and Connect IQ, but the smartwatch will receive notifications and other alerts from your smartphone.

Speaking of notifications, Garmin Instinct is compatible with Android and iOS devices, but some features like smart reply will only work on Android.
